Beginner144h72 lessons Certificate
Full-Stack Web Development with PHP
Comprehensive 6-month course (12 lessons per month, 2-hour duration)
Transform from complete beginner to job-ready full-stack developer in 6 months. Master HTML, CSS, JavaScript, jQuery, PHP, and MySQL to build real-world web applications. This comprehensive bootcamp covers everything you need to start your career in web development, with hands-on projects and industry best practices.
What You'll Learn
HTML5 semantic markup and accessibility standards
CSS3 advanced styling, Flexbox, and Grid layout
Responsive design for mobile, tablet, and desktop
JavaScript ES6+ fundamentals and advanced concepts
DOM manipulation and event handling
jQuery library for rapid development
AJAX and asynchronous programming
PHP programming from basics to advanced
Object-Oriented Programming (OOP) in PHP
MySQL database design and normalization
SQL queries, joins, and optimization
PHP & MySQL integration (PDO/MySQLi)
Form validation and data sanitization
Session management and cookies
User authentication and authorization systems
File upload, storage, and manipulation
Security best practices (SQL injection, XSS prevention)
RESTful principles and simple APIs
Version control with Git and GitHub
Deployment to production servers
3 real-world portfolio projects
Final capstone e-commerce project
Prerequisites
Basic computer usage skills
Basic English proficiency (for technical documentation)
Willingness to learn and solve problems
No prior programming experience required
Learning Path
Module 1: Web Fundamentals
4 weeks
Module 1
- HTML5 semantic elements and structure
- CSS3 fundamentals and selectors
- Flexbox and Grid layouts
- + 2 more topics
Module 2: JavaScript Fundamentals
5 weeks
Module 2
- JavaScript syntax and variables
- Data types and operators
- Functions and scope
- + 3 more topics
Module 3: Advanced JavaScript & jQuery
4 weeks
Module 3
- ES6+ modern features
- Arrays and objects
- AJAX and Fetch API
- + 2 more topics
Module 4: PHP Fundamentals
5 weeks
Module 4
- PHP syntax and variables
- Form handling and validation
- Sessions and cookies
- + 3 more topics
Module 5: MySQL Database
4 weeks
Module 5
- Database design and normalization
- SQL queries (SELECT, INSERT, UPDATE, DELETE)
- Joins and relationships
- + 2 more topics
Module 6: PHP OOP & Advanced Topics
4 weeks
Module 6
- Classes and objects
- Inheritance and polymorphism
- MVC architecture
- + 3 more topics
Module 7: Final Capstone Project
6 weeks
Module 7
- E-commerce application architecture
- User authentication and authorization
- Product catalog and search
- + 4 more topics
Course Completion & Certificate
Course Curriculum
1Module 1: Web Fundamentals
4 weeks
1
Module 1: Web Fundamentals
4 weeks
- HTML5 semantic elements and structure
- CSS3 fundamentals and selectors
- Flexbox and Grid layouts
- Responsive design and media queries
- Project: Personal portfolio website
2Module 2: JavaScript Fundamentals
5 weeks
2
Module 2: JavaScript Fundamentals
5 weeks
- JavaScript syntax and variables
- Data types and operators
- Functions and scope
- DOM manipulation
- Event handling
- Project: Interactive web game
3Module 3: Advanced JavaScript & jQuery
4 weeks
3
Module 3: Advanced JavaScript & jQuery
4 weeks
- ES6+ modern features
- Arrays and objects
- AJAX and Fetch API
- jQuery fundamentals and plugins
- Project: Weather app with API
4Module 4: PHP Fundamentals
5 weeks
4
Module 4: PHP Fundamentals
5 weeks
- PHP syntax and variables
- Form handling and validation
- Sessions and cookies
- File upload and processing
- Error handling
- Project: Contact form and file manager
5Module 5: MySQL Database
4 weeks
5
Module 5: MySQL Database
4 weeks
- Database design and normalization
- SQL queries (SELECT, INSERT, UPDATE, DELETE)
- Joins and relationships
- PDO and prepared statements
- Project: Blog system
6Module 6: PHP OOP & Advanced Topics
4 weeks
6
Module 6: PHP OOP & Advanced Topics
4 weeks
- Classes and objects
- Inheritance and polymorphism
- MVC architecture
- Security (SQL injection, XSS)
- RESTful API basics
- Project: Task management system
7Module 7: Final Capstone Project
6 weeks
7
Module 7: Final Capstone Project
6 weeks
- E-commerce application architecture
- User authentication and authorization
- Product catalog and search
- Shopping cart and payment integration
- Admin panel
- Production deployment
- Git and GitHub collaboration
Career Opportunities
Junior Full-Stack Developer
Frontend Developer
Backend PHP Developer
Web Developer
WordPress Developer
Freelance Web Developer
Technologies Covered
HTML5CSS3JavaScriptjQueryPHPMySQL
50,000 ֏
Includes Certificate of Completion
Let's Work Together
Ready to innovate?
Let's discuss your project and bring your ideas to life
